What we do?
Client Asset Protection - Client Assets Engineering is at the core of Client Protection and Collateral Management functions for Goldman Sachs globally. Our platform is responsible for segregating customer assets, implementing complex optimization calculations, and controls across business functions and asset classes, governed and monitored by regulation across various jurisdictions (US-SEC/FINRA, UK-FCA, JP-FSA, etc.). Our platforms manage client assets worth approximately $1 trillion in segregation and facilitate funding opportunities on client margin worth around $100 billion for the firm.
Responsibilities
* Manage end-to-end systems development cycle in an Agile environment, from requirements analysis to coding, testing, UAT, implementation, and maintenance.
* Develop high-level and detailed technical designs, testing strategies, and implementation plans.
* Work in a dynamic, fast-paced environment that provides exposure to all areas of finance.
* Understand and respond to business needs, developing process workflows, data requirements, and specifications to support implementation.
* Build strong relationships with business partners.
* Identify opportunities for cross-divisional collaboration and reuse of common solutions.
* Engage in data modeling and curation.
Basic Qualifications
* Bachelor's degree or relevant work experience in Computer Science, Mathematics, Electrical Engineering, or related technical discipline.
* 2-5 years of software development experience.
* Excellent object-oriented or functional analysis and design skills.
* Knowledge of data structures, algorithms, and performance optimization.
* Excellent communication skills, with experience speaking to technical and business audiences globally.
* Problem-solving ability and data-driven decision-making skills.
* Ability to multi-task, manage multiple stakeholders, and work as part of a global team.
* An entrepreneurial approach and passion for problem solving and product development.
Expert Knowledge in One or More of
* Programming in Java, with experience in concurrency and memory management.
* Strong RDBMS knowledge.
* Experience developing distributed, microservices-based applications.
* Experience with data modeling and curation for large datasets.
* Experience with cloud technologies, including building finance systems on cloud platforms like AWS S3, Snowflake, etc.
Preferred Qualifications
* Interest or knowledge in investment banking or financial instruments.
* Experience with big data concepts, such as Hadoop for Data Lake.
* Experience with near real-time transactional systems like Kafka.
* Experience in Business Process Management (BPM).
ABOUT GOLDMAN SACHS
At Goldman Sachs, we dedicate our people, capital, and ideas to help our clients, shareholders, and communities grow. Founded in 1869, we are a leading global investment banking, securities, and investment management firm, headquartered in New York with offices worldwide.
We value diversity and inclusion, providing opportunities for professional and personal growth through training, development programs, and benefits. Learn more at GS.com/careers.
We are committed to providing reasonable accommodations for candidates with disabilities during our recruitment process. More info: Disability Statement.
© Goldman Sachs Group, Inc., 2023. All rights reserved.
Goldman Sachs is an equal employment/affirmative action employer committed to diversity and inclusion.
#J-18808-Ljbffr